What is a remote content director?

A Remote Content Director is a professional responsible for overseeing the planning, creation, and management of digital content for an organization while working from a location outside the traditional office. They lead content teams, develop content strategies, and ensure that all content aligns with the brand’s goals and messaging. Operating remotely, they often use digital tools to coordinate projects, communicate with team members, and track performance metrics. This role requires strong leadership, organizational, and communication skills, as well as experience in content marketing or digital media.

How does a remote content director effectively manage and collaborate with distributed teams?

As a Remote Content Director, you will typically oversee a team of writers, editors, and strategists who may be spread across different locations and time zones. Effective management often relies on clear communication, regular virtual meetings, and the use of collaborative project management tools such as Slack, Trello, or Asana. Building strong relationships, setting clear expectations, and fostering an inclusive remote culture are crucial for maintaining productivity and team morale. Additionally, you’ll need to adapt your leadership style to accommodate asynchronous workflows and ensure all team members feel supported, engaged, and aligned with the overall content strategy.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a remote content director,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Remote Content Director, you need expertise in content strategy, editorial oversight, and digital marketing, typically supported by a degree in communications, journalism, or a related field. Familiarity with content management systems (CMS), SEO tools, analytics platforms, and project management software is essential. Strong leadership, collaboration, time management, and communication skills distinguish top performers in this remote role. These skills ensure high-quality, consistent content delivery that aligns with business goals and effectively leads distributed teams.

What is the difference between Remote Content Director vs Remote Content Manager?

AspectRemote Content DirectorRemote Content Manager
ResponsibilitiesOversees content strategy, leads content teams, sets visionManages content creation, editing, and publishing processes
Required SkillsStrategic planning, leadership, content developmentContent editing, project management, team coordination
Work EnvironmentHigh-level leadership, cross-department collaborationTeam management, content production focus
Common UsageUsed in larger organizations or agenciesUsed in mid-sized companies or departments

The main difference between a Remote Content Director and a Remote Content Manager lies in scope and responsibility. The Director focuses on strategic oversight and leadership, while the Manager handles day-to-day content operations. Both roles require strong content knowledge, but the Director's role is more about guiding overall content vision.
